Family instead of Djokovic
Interesting fact: Murray even "ditches" Novak Djokovic for his excursion into the snow. Murray has recently been acting as Djokovic's coach. However, according to media reports, the Scot's family vacation had been planned for some time, so he practically let Djokovic travel solo to his first tournament of the year in Brisbane.
Doubles with Kyrgios
But even without Murray, Djokovic is causing a stir - even garnished with an Austrian connection. Djokovic is playing doubles in Brisbane with a certain Nick Krygios. The two have developed a friendship in the recent past. Kyrgios' comeback was accompanied by a clash between a pairing with a red-white-red tinge: Austria's Alexander Erler and his partner Andreas Miles lost 4-6, 7-6(4), 8-10 to the Djokovic/Kyrgios pairing.
